BBC Scotland understands the UK government is likely to permit the scheme - with several conditions.
She said: "It is an outrage that in an area that is fully devolved that the UK government and the Secretary of State for Scotland Alister Jack would seek to interfere yet again in a scheme that is wholly devolved for no other reason really than because they can."The deposit return scheme, aimed at increasing the number of single-use drinks bottles and cans that are recycled, was due to begin in August.
Concerns have been raised that because Scotland's scheme would come in before similar initiatives in England, Wales and Northern Ireland, it could create a trade barrier.in a bid to ensure smooth trade across the different nations of the UK. Asked if she would compensate businesses if the scheme failed, Lorna Slater said that was a hypothetical question because she remained committed to delivering the scheme next March.
